IVLP Africa Regional: Workforce and Business Development: Pathways for Youth

A group of 13 professionals from Cote d’Ivoire (2), Ghana, Guinea, Mali, Namibia (2), Niger, Nigeria, Rwanda, Sudan, Zimbabwe (2) along with three liaisons will be in Kalamazoo through the State Department’s International Visitor Leadership Program (IVLP).

Kalamazoo is a short stop on their 20+ day trip in the United States.

Their time here will focus on workforce exploration and development for youth, including trades, apprenticeships, cooperative education, mentoring, and internships, as well as how youth workforce development programs impact the greater community. Best practices and policy and funding for workforce development programs for youth will also be explored.
